mirror of
https://github.com/openclaw/openclaw.git
synced 2026-05-18 21:24:46 +00:00
Summary: - Preserve inbound sender metadata and source-channel provenance in Codex app-server prompt mirrors. - Reuse the shared prompt-mirror builder for normal and `turn/start` failure snapshots. - Add regression coverage for provider variants such as `discord-voice` while keeping `sourceChannel` on the originating channel. Verification: - `pnpm test extensions/codex/src/app-server/event-projector.test.ts extensions/codex/src/app-server/run-attempt.test.ts` - `pnpm exec oxfmt --check extensions/codex/src/app-server/transcript-mirror.ts extensions/codex/src/app-server/event-projector.test.ts extensions/codex/src/app-server/run-attempt.test.ts` - `git diff --check temp/landpr-82184..HEAD` - `/Users/steipete/Projects/agent-scripts/skills/codex-review/scripts/codex-review --parallel-tests "pnpm test extensions/codex/src/app-server/event-projector.test.ts extensions/codex/src/app-server/run-attempt.test.ts"`